Personal and commercial lines insurer MMA Insurance has bought Swinton, the predominantly personal lines intermediary chain, from Royal & SunAlliance Insurance.
Swinton managing director Glyn Jones is leaving the company after seven years, with Patrick Smith, currently chairman of internet intermediary its4me, taking over as chief executive. Swinton will be run independently of MMA by a new company, MMA Holdings, formed specifically for this purpose.
